❓ What is a black triangle?
It is a space that looks dark and triangular between two teeth, near the top of the gum line.
In professional terms, it’s called an “interdental black triangle.”
🔍 Why does it happen?
✅ It can happen as the gums recede. As we get older,
after orthodontic treatment, or due to gum disease, the gum tissue that
fills the space between teeth (the papilla) shrinks, creating a triangular space.
✅ In some cases, the shape of the teeth itself is the cause. If the teeth get wider toward the top,
a space can naturally appear at the gum line.
✅ It can also appear newly after orthodontic treatment!
If the teeth move but the original gum tissue cannot follow,
black triangles may appear after treatment is completed.
💡 How is it treated?
It depends on the condition and position of the teeth,
✔️ adjusting the shape of the teeth with laminate veneers, or
✔️ removing a tiny amount of enamel between the teeth (IPR) to eliminate the space,
✔️ or combining these with gum contouring.
